Don’t Let It Change You
Delivered by Bishop Joseph W. Walker, III
Synopsis of Sermon May 3, 2020
Genesis 50:20 NIV – “You intended to harm me, but God intended it for good to accomplish what is now being done, the saving of many lives.”

- Look at the life of Joseph. Like Joseph, our life has a lot to do with how we manage Moments. Joseph’s brothers were jealous of his relationship with their father.
-
- Joseph has visions or dreams. When he shares his dreams with his brothers and they began to hate him for what the dreams said. As a result, they try and stage Joseph’s death. They place him in the pit to die.
- Joseph is found by Potiphar and as a result, he goes to Potiphar’s house, goes to prison, and there his gift is revealed. Joseph is then sent to Potiphar and he is elevated in the house of Potiphar. This causes him to be put into a position to save the Egyptian Nation.
- Joseph’s success and failures were all tied to how he managed the moment.
- Every stage of Joseph’s life, there was success. There will be moments where you and I will get tests like Joseph and you will have to manage that moment. Whatever happens in life, don’t let it change you.

- Pharaoh has a dream, and no one is able to figure it out. The Butler informs Pharaoh that he has someone in his prison that interprets dreams. Joseph, just like that, was brought out of prison and placed in front of Pharaoh.
- Joseph interprets the dream. He determines that the dream meant that this region would have 7 years of harvest and 7 years of famine. As a result, Joseph told Pharaoh that he needed to store in the time of great harvest, so that they could live off of what they had stored up during the famine.
- Pharaoh elevates Joseph and leaves him in charge of distributing the bread or in other words, what they stored up. God is about to elevate you and you’re about to be a God is about to make you a blessing to others.

- All things work together for the good of them that love the Lord and are called according to his purpose. If Joseph had never been hated on, he would have never been in pit. If he had never been in the pit, then Joseph wouldn’t have ended up in Potiphar’s house. If Joseph had never been in Potiphar’s house, then he would have never been lied on. If Joseph hadn’t been lied on, he wouldn’t have ended up in prison. If Joseph had not been put into prison, then he wouldn’t have met the people that knew Pharaoh, that when Pharaoh had a problem, his gift wouldn’t have come to the forefront. If that hadn’t happened, then you wouldn’t have gotten to this place to manage the Moment for God’s glory.
